With "GNU Emacs 24.3.1 (i386-mingw-nt6.1.7601)" and aspell 0.50.3 I'm 
struggling with how to define and maintain personal word lists for four 
different languages. I find myself swamped in the different versions of aspell, 
multiple ispell.el variables related to personal dictionaries, and command-line 
arguments passed to aspell.

The goal is to use a language-specific personal dictionary that corresponds to 
the language being checked, to update that dictionary routinely whenever I 
specify to add a word, and to be able to switch personal dictionaries when 
switching among languages within a buffer.

I'd love to see a unified description of how accomplish this, or a real-world 
example, especially from someone who has it working.
